The Making of 'Dog Day Afternoon' (2006)

The Making of 'Dog Day Afternoon' (2006)

directed by Laurent Bouzereau

58 minutes

The following people were interviewed for this documentary
  • Dede Allen, editor
  • Martin Bregman, producer
  • Charles Durning, Moretti
  • Burtt Harris, assistant director
  • Lance Henriksen, Murphy
  • Victor Kemper, cinematography
  • Sidney Lumet, director
  • Al Pacino, Sonny
  • Frank Pierson, writer
  • Chris Sarandon, Leon
The documentary is divided into four segments.
  • The Story
  • Casting the Controversy
  • Recreating the Facts
  • After the Filming
Frank Pierson is the dominant presence in the first segment. Sidney Lumet is the dominant presence in the other three segments.
